Transaction 746fbf7739a03f54e9033ee901547497bc038362e40bb959a2cda752be0a3754
1 Input
2 Outputs
- 746fbf7739a03f54e9033ee901547497bc038362e40bb959a2cda752be0a3754:0
- 746fbf7739a03f54e9033ee901547497bc038362e40bb959a2cda752be0a3754:1
value 45456
address 3LwA6j8TEd2xds4HrYb9A4dsERaeRsBZWY
value 17565
address 1Puk8EsGnhF8f2H84kFLsZ972W5FEEDxMn